What is a Dual Cooker?
A Dual Fuel Cookers Cooker (Biasharaafricabusinessclub.org), often described as a multi-cooker, is an all-in-one kitchen device that combines the functions of multiple cooking devices. Usually, a dual cooker can press cook, sluggish cook, steam, sauté, and even brown food. With this device, users can prepare meals that usually require various cooking approaches in one single pot, conserving time and effort.

Time Efficiency: A dual cooker can significantly reduce cooking time. For instance, pressure cooking can cut cooking times by approximately 70%. This is particularly advantageous for hectic people who require to prepare meals quickly.
Space-Saving: Instead of cluttering your kitchen with numerous appliances, a dual cooker combines functions into one, conserving important countertop and storage area.
Consistent Results: The programmable settings on dual cookers enable exact cooking. Whether it's a fragile risotto or hearty beef stew, you can achieve consistent outcomes every time.
Versatile Cooking Options: From soups and stews to rice and yogurt, dual cookers can handle a diverse series of dishes, making them ideal for numerous dietary choices.
Streamlined Meal Prep: With a dual cooker, preparing meals ahead of time ends up being easier. Users can batch cook and cool or freeze meals for later consumption.

Using a dual cooker is straightforward. Here's a step-by-step guide:
Preparation: Gather all essential components and tools. Refer to the recipe for any particular instructions.
Picking Functions: Depending on your dish, pick the proper cooking function (pressure, sluggish cook, and so on).
Setting Time: Set the cooking time according to the recipe guidelines. For pressure cooking, guarantee the steam vent is sealed.
Cooking: Start the cooker and monitor the procedure if your design enables. Enjoy the time you conserve!
Natural Pressure Release: Once cooking is completed, use the natural or quick release method as needed.

1. Can a dual cooker really change multiple kitchen appliances?
Yes, it combines the performances of numerous appliances, making it an excellent replacement for sluggish cookers, rice cookers, steamer baskets, and more.
2. Are dual cookers safe to utilize?
When utilized according to the producer's instructions, dual cookers are generally really safe. Many include integrated safety functions to prevent accidents.
3. How do I preserve my dual cooker?
Routinely tidy the pot and cover, and ensure the sealing ring is in good condition. Follow the producer's guide for specific upkeep ideas.
4. Can I cook frozen food in a dual cooker?
Yes, many dual cookers enable you to cook frozen food, however it's vital to adjust the cooking time appropriately.
5. What types of meals can I prepare with a dual cooker?
You can prepare soups, stews, rice, yogurt, casseroles, and even desserts like cakes and puddings.
